
Crisp, sweet apple wedges paired with a creamy, savory-edged dip make for a snack that feels indulgent without any of the fuss. Sunflower seed butter steps in beautifully here โ it's rich and nutty in flavor, completely plant-based, and naturally free from the nightshade family, so there's no need to scrutinize labels for hidden pepper derivatives or spice blends that can sneak in unwanted ingredients. A pinch of sea salt and a dusting of cinnamon transform the dip from simple to genuinely craveable. The optional squeeze of lemon juice keeps those apple slices looking fresh and bright if you're prepping ahead for lunchboxes or a party spread. It comes together in just a few minutes with no cooking required, which makes it an easy go-to when you need something satisfying fast. Honeycrisp or Fuji apples bring just the right balance of sweetness and crunch to stand up to that thick, hearty dip.

Core and slice the apples into even wedges, about 8โ10 slices per apple. If not serving immediately, toss the slices with the lemon juice, if using, to prevent browning.
In a small bowl, stir together the sunflower seed butter, cinnamon, and salt until evenly combined.
